Firstly, this specimen is NOT REPAIRED as so many of these classic combos are, today on the market. Also, it is from the older classic locales near Florissant, near to but not from the modern Smoky Hawk claims. It is probably 1960s-1970s vintage, but no way to tell for sure now. The specimen has all the qualities you would want in a combo from here, but without the typically high prices they go for (all things being relative) as I exchanged it from a collection at a fair trade price: great color amazonite; great color smokies; translucence to the quartz; and overall good aesthetics. AND, it has no repairs, which I find remarkable. It is pristine and undamaged, with a great horizon edge to any display angle. At 5 inches across, its of good size, too. A modern specimen of such aspect (with repairs) might run around 20k on the open market these days. ex Steve Neely collection, with label.
